Output 586917d3da21f9fbaad29529686f7f8bd2f445b25207433cd78445940a8b4b9a:1

value
2681043025
script pubkey
OP_0 OP_PUSHBYTES_20 d8aaf0cb0d4b596249cc4673e6072ae01b79ea5a
address
ltc1qmz40pjcdfdvkyjwvgee7vpe2uqdhn6j6mtwzaj
transaction
586917d3da21f9fbaad29529686f7f8bd2f445b25207433cd78445940a8b4b9a
spent
true